So, it's a drone with uncessercary baggage such life support and a pilot that can't stand the Gs well. For some reason I am reminded of Dark Star :-)

Pretty much, but it's building on top of the previous QF program [0][1] where the USAF would retrofit retired jets like the F-4 and older F-16s as drones for target training. They used to be remotely controlled but the VENOM platform is testing complete autonomy.

Because the most powerful military in the world can only do so much when ordered to execute a crap strategy by civilian leadership. Desert Storm worked because it followed the Powell Doctrine and was bounded to ejecting Iraq from Kuwait. Iraqi Freedom muddled through incoherently because the Bush and Obama administrations didn't want to understand the actual problem set they were faced with, but ultimately ended up with a reasonably stable country after way too much effort and time. Iran is what happens when you have an administration who thinks you can win a war by "just bombing things," which is ironically the stereotype most of the internet has about any kind of military action.

Human control in flight has often taken a backseat to automation. For example, the SR-71, built in the 60s flew too fast to rely on human decision making for several tasks. If they were off by a fraction of a second, they would miss their intended recon target; so, both the navigation and sensor control were largely automated. The way I see it, this is the JDAM of drones. Will it perform better than purpose built aircraft? No. But the USAF has a few hundred old F-16s entering retirement that would be mothballed otherwise, and strapping some cheap sensors to them is a fast way to play around with the idea while they wait for Lockheed and Anduril to finish the good stuff.

The field demo I want to see, Human in the loop to failure switch over: Simulated failure of some form, where (for safety reasons) crew triggers ejection. This defaults the system to autonomous mode and the plane performs a safe landing.

Auto GCAS (Ground Collision Avoidance System) exists (pre-AI), although it is nowhere near as sophisticated as what you described. Similar type of idea though.

If the pilot passes out during high-g maneuvers, the aircraft will pull up and bring the wings level until the pilot regains consciousness.
